turning my life around after long term illness
Monday, 29 October 2012 12:48 PM

I am a 45 year old divorced mum of one who''s had a long term mental illness. The bad news is that I haven''t worked full-time for over 20 years and am chemically dependent on meds - I have tried to withdraw many times but get a rebound effect when I try. I also had an emotionally neglectful & abusive upbringing which caused the mental illness. The good news is that I have been volunteering for over three years - have some admin, reception & cashiering experience and am intelligent, trustworthy, presentable and with good listening skills and able to learn.

I am looking for someone to help mentor me to turn things around and get out of the poverty and life trap which I find myself in.
